Konrad Adenauer Stiftung (KAS) Climate Diplomacy Academy 2024

Application Deadline: 26th January 2024.

Applications are now open for the 2024 Konrad Adenauer Stiftung (KAS) Climate Diplomacy Academy.

Konrad Adenauer Stiftung (KAS) is a German Political Foundation committed to fostering democracy and the rule of law, implementing social and market-economic structures, and promoting human rights worldwide. Currently, KAS hosts more than 200 projects in around 100 countries on four continents with about 80 field offices, including 20 offices in Sub-Saharan Africa. The KAS Regional Programme Energy Security and Climate Change in Sub-Saharan Africa has been operational since 2016 with its head office in Nairobi, Kenya.

Through the coordination of activities in the Sub-Saharan part of the continent, the Programme has a mission to improve the political and social framework for climatefriendly sustainable development, stronger regional and international cooperation on energy, security, and climate action in Sub-Saharan Africa countries. The fight against global warming, the sustainable use of resources and adaptation, and mitigation of climate-related risks and disasters are among the greatest challenges facing the world today. Multilateralism and international diplomacy are key to finding solutions to these global tasks.

Within this context, the Regional Programme Energy Security and Climate Change in Sub-Saharan Africa in partnership with Strathmore University will implement the 4th Climate Diplomacy Academy (CDA2024) from April to June 2024.

A three-day physical conference will take place at the end of June 2024 at Strathmore University, Nairobi. KAS will cover all costs related to participation in this physical conference for selected participants.

Eligibility

Eligible candidates must meet the following requirements: i

  • Should not be older than 35 years
  • At least 3rd year undergraduate students in the following subjects: International Studies, Environmental Science, Political Science, Development Studies or related field.
  • Have a good command of spoken and written English
  • Interest in current international and multilateral discussions and negotiations on climate change
  • Ability to work on assignments between April and June 2024 for approximately 5 hours per week.
  • Availability to travel to Nairobi, Kenya in the week of 17th June 2024

How to apply

Interested students/young professionals should submit the following documents:

  • Curriculum vitae, not more than two pages
  • Letter of motivation
  • A short essay (1-2 pages) on the following topic:

    – How can international cooperation strengthen the fight against climate change and its impacts in Africa? All documents must be submitted as one PDF to info.climate-nairobi@kas.de
  • Deadline for applications: 26th January 2024. Only applications received by this deadline will be reviewed.
